Im not a person who swears a lot, but this tea makes me want to say bad words that’s how good it is…Mandala, what are you doing to me?

First, Colored Species is such an appropriate name for it, never seen such saturated almost glowing emerald green leaves before and I’ve had tons of green oolongs. Just stunning.

On the opposite end of the spectrum, the liquor that it produces could be called Colorless Species. It gains a bit of pigmentation with later steeps, but barely.

The first three infusions develop into a nice floral taste as the leaves unfurl. It is actually hard to describe cause it’s unlike any other green oolongs I’ve had. It’s not overly anything, if that makes sense. Not overly floral, not overly grassy, not overly mineral, but a perfect amalgam of all three.
